The Cox School of Business has identified a new path toward earning a Master of Business Administration (MBA) for recent college graduates with less than two years of post-degree work experience, including Class of 2020 graduates completing their undergraduate degrees this month. The new Cox MBA Direct program will allow recent college graduates who are working full-time to begin MBA studies online upon completion of their undergraduate degree. It will also prepare them to secure MBA-level employment by obtaining needed work experience as they complete their MBA degree. Motivated students can achieve MBA-level salaries within three years of finishing their undergraduate degrees. SMU Cox will waive the GMAT/GRE for applicants of all Fall 2020 Cox graduate programs, including this new program. The deadline to apply under this temporary waiver policy is August 2, 2020.
